Description
A type confusion vulnerability exists in Serv-U which when exploited, gives a malicious actor the ability to execute arbitrary native code as privileged account. This issue requires administrative privileges to abuse. On Windows deployments, the risk is scored as a medium because services frequently run under less-privileged service accounts by default.
EPSS Score:
0%
Comprehensive Technical Analysis of EUVD-2025-207544
1. Vulnerability Assessment and Severity Evaluation
The vulnerability described in EUVD-2025-207544 is a type confusion issue in SolarWinds Serv-U, which allows a malicious actor to execute arbitrary native code with administrative privileges. The CVSS (Common Vulnerability Scoring System) base score of 9.1 indicates a critical severity level. The scoring vector C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:C/C:H/I:H/A:H breaks down as follows:
- AV:N (Attack Vector: Network): The vulnerability can be exploited remotely over the network.
- AC:L (Attack Complexity: Low): The attack is relatively straightforward to execute.
- PR:H (Privileges Required: High): The attacker needs administrative privileges to exploit the vulnerability.
- UI:N (User Interaction: None): No user interaction is required for the attack to succeed.
- S:C (Scope: Changed): The vulnerability affects a component that is outside the security scope of the vulnerable component.
- C:H (Confidentiality: High): The vulnerability can result in a complete breach of confidentiality.
- I:H (Integrity: High): The vulnerability can result in a complete breach of integrity.
- A:H (Availability: High): The vulnerability can result in a complete breach of availability.
2. Potential Attack Vectors and Exploitation Methods
Given the type confusion vulnerability, potential attack vectors include:
- Remote Code Execution (RCE): An attacker could exploit the vulnerability to execute arbitrary code on the target system.
- Privilege Escalation: Although administrative privileges are required to exploit the vulnerability, an attacker could use it to escalate privileges further or maintain persistence on the compromised system.
- Data Exfiltration: The attacker could exfiltrate sensitive data by executing malicious code with high privileges.
Exploitation methods might involve crafting specific payloads that trigger the type confusion, leading to code execution. This could be achieved through network-based attacks targeting the Serv-U service.
3. Affected Systems and Software Versions
The vulnerability affects SolarWinds Serv-U versions 15.5.3 and prior. Organizations using these versions are at risk and should prioritize updating to the latest version.
4. Recommended Mitigation Strategies
To mitigate the risk associated with this vulnerability, the following strategies are recommended:
- Patch Management: Immediately update to the latest version of SolarWinds Serv-U (15.5.4 or later) as per the release notes.
- Access Control: Ensure that only authorized personnel have administrative access to the Serv-U service.
- Network Segmentation: Implement network segmentation to limit the exposure of the Serv-U service to trusted networks.
- Monitoring and Logging: Enhance monitoring and logging for the Serv-U service to detect any suspicious activities.
- Intrusion Detection/Prevention Systems (IDS/IPS): Deploy IDS/IPS to detect and prevent potential exploitation attempts.
5. Impact on European Cybersecurity Landscape
The impact of this vulnerability on the European cybersecurity landscape is significant, particularly for organizations that rely on SolarWinds Serv-U for file transfer and management. Given the critical nature of the vulnerability, it poses a substantial risk to data integrity, confidentiality, and availability. Organizations in sectors such as finance, healthcare, and government, which handle sensitive data, are particularly at risk.
6. Technical Details for Security Professionals
For security professionals, the following technical details are pertinent:
- Type Confusion Vulnerability: This type of vulnerability occurs when a program uses or manipulates a resource (such as a variable or object) based on an incorrect assumption about its type. In this case, the Serv-U service incorrectly handles certain types of data, leading to code execution.
- Exploitation: The exploitation involves sending specially crafted data to the Serv-U service, which triggers the type confusion and allows for code execution.
- Detection: Security professionals should look for unusual network traffic patterns, unexpected service restarts, or unauthorized access attempts in logs.
- Response: In case of an incident, isolate the affected system, perform a thorough forensic analysis, and apply the necessary patches and updates.
Conclusion
The vulnerability EUVD-2025-207544 in SolarWinds Serv-U is critical and requires immediate attention. Organizations should prioritize updating to the latest version of Serv-U and implement robust security measures to mitigate the risk. The potential impact on European cybersecurity underscores the importance of proactive vulnerability management and incident response strategies.